My car is on limp mode after manual swap
I have a 2008 E90 325i. I did the manual swap, did the clutch switch wiring as per the manual. I did the coding too, like removing the $205 from cas VO, doing FA_Write and did the FA_write to NFRM. Then did the sg_coderein to CAS, NFRM, DSC, KOMBI, DME too. I don't why but my car is still in limp, it's not giving power as a manual.
Any help please? |

Assuming you did the wiring and coding correctly, nothing obvious springs to mind. To clarify, it cranks and starts?
Post the codes you’re getting because that will almost certainly highlight the issue. NZE90 It’s been so long now that I can’t remember all the little details. But I don’t believe any flashing was required. Just a matter of default coding with updated VO .
